How can I add brushes? I found a way, but it won't work. :( Please help!
PowerPuff53 1 month ago
@PowerPuff53 First you download the brushes you wanna put on your bg (for example at deviantart) Second you open photoshop and open the brush menu like at did around 7:30 . Third you right click on your bg and you open the same bar as i did at 7:42. Now there's this option in the bar called 'load brushes ' . Click on it and find your downloaded file. Et voilà :) there are your brushes! Now you can continue the same as i did in this tutorial but now with your brushes :)
